Comedian Tom Ballard talks about his Melbourne International Comedy Festival show Good Point Well Made and his YouTube series IT IS I; Dr. Jen addresses the question: Can we learn to be happy?; comedian Nazeem Hussain explains what it’s like to be Totally Normal; film reviewer Megan McKeough discusses Rose Glass’ new thriller Love Lies Bleeding; botanist Tim Entwhistle chats about his appearance at an ACMI panel event, titled Reconnecting to Nature; and American comedian Zainab Johnson shares her experience of performing for an Australian audience. With presenters Monique Sebire, Daniel Burt & Nat Harris.
